The 2022 Domaine Berthet Rayne Châteauneuf-du-Pape Tradition Rouge is an organic, full-bodied red blend from the Rhône region of France. The wine is structured, with notes of dark fruit, herbs, and spices, and is ready to drink now but will benefit from additional aging. Expect a complex bouquet of fruits, herbs, and spices. Specific notes include sour cherry, ripe raspberry, blackcurrant, juicy plum, dried herbs, licorice, and black pepper, with hints of garrigue (wild herbs). The palate is full-bodied, with a silky and generous texture. Flavors of dark cherry compote, blackberry jam, and mulled spices are complemented by savory notes of dried thyme, leather, and tobacco. The tannins are chalky but well-integrated, and there is a long, lingering finish. The 2022 Domaine Berthet Rayne Châteauneuf-du-Pape Tradition Rouge is a high-quality example of its type, combining a silky richness with a structured, dry finish. Its complex layers of fruit, herbs, and earth make it a versatile wine for food pairing and an excellent choice for anyone who appreciates the classic style of Châteauneuf-du-Pape.
